AAGPS RUGBY TIPPING COMP 2016

Rules

1) Competition to be run over 1st , 2nd & 3rd XV games. Competition games only, does not include this weekends 3rds comp.

2) 2 points awarded for each successful win picked. 4 points awarded if a draw is picked successfully. A draw will result in 1 point.

3) Tips must be in before 3rds Kick off, (11;00 am Saturday) but prefer they were in by Friday.

4) Late Tips and No Tips will automatically revert to the AWAY teams

5) Tips should be given using the School Letter - Use 3 rows, 1st Row for 1st XV, 2nd row for 2nd XV and 3rd Row for 3rds. PLEASE DO NOT SPACE OR COMMA. USE UPPERCASE LETTERS. And please always use the order as per the AAGPS fixtures. This allow for easy cutting and pasting into the table. Please refer to my tips below.

I will Table up HJ's collated post of all the tips so far and post.

6) it would be so good if you were to also Private message me with your tips at the same time you post on the forum- Saves scrolling through hundreds of posts looking for everyone's tips.

7) Late entries - Will take late entries up to Round 3, Sorry to disappoint any late comers but it a hassle and really not much point. This is for the G&G obsessed and dedicated only. Not for those that turn up late for games.

8) Winnings - The ultimate winner and/or winners, will win no more than some Kudos and bragging rights on G&G.

9) Can everyone supporting a particular school set up a school flag. You have to google HEX colour codes and get a code for your school colour. For Shore I used Navy Blue 000062 and White ffffff and Navy 000062. You do this in the personal details tab. I will try and include these plus the Avatars in the table.

10) Also please post your predicted TOP 3 placings overall in order - In the absence of a Poll , I will include the overall prediction in the table. PM me again if possible, Will allow changes on this up to RD 3

11) Any of these rules can change at any time
